Ingredients You’ll Need
To make your Overnight Oats Facon Carrot Cake, gather the following ingredients:
- 1 cup rolled oats
- 1 cup milk (or non-dairy milk such as almond or oat milk)
- 1/2 cup grated carrots (about 1 medium carrot)
- 1/4 cup Greek yogurt (optional for extra creaminess)
- 1 tablespoon maple syrup or honey (adjust to taste)
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- 1/4 teaspoon ground nutmeg
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 cup raisins or chopped walnuts (optional)
- Toasted coconut flakes for topping (optional)
Step-by-Step Instructions
Creating your Overnight Oats Facon Carrot Cake is simple and quick. Follow these easy steps:
- Combine Dry Ingredients: In a medium bowl, mix the rolled oats, cinnamon, nutmeg, and salt. This ensures the spices are evenly distributed throughout the oats.
- Add Carrots and Sweetener: Stir in the grated carrots, maple syrup (or honey), and any nuts or raisins you’re using. This will add texture and sweetness to your oats.
- Mix Wet Ingredients: In a separate bowl, whisk together milk, Greek yogurt, and vanilla extract until smooth. This creamy mixture will help bind all the ingredients together.
- Combine Everything: Pour the wet ingredients into the dry mixture and stir until well combined. Make sure all the oats are coated with the liquid.
- Refrigerate Overnight: Divide the mixture into jars or containers with tight-fitting lids. Seal them and place them in the refrigerator overnight (or for at least 4 hours) to allow the oats to soak up the liquid.
Variations to Try
While the classic Overnight Oats Facon Carrot Cake recipe is delicious on its own, feel free to experiment with these variations:
- Add Pineapple: For a tropical twist, mix in crushed pineapple or pineapple chunks. The sweetness of the pineapple pairs beautifully with the spices.
- Use Different Nuts: Instead of walnuts, try pecans or almonds for a different flavor and crunch.
- Switch Up the Sweetener: Try using agave nectar, date syrup, or coconut sugar for a different sweetness profile.
- Incorporate Protein: Add a scoop of protein powder or nut butter for an extra protein boost that will keep you full longer.
- Top with Fresh Fruits: Before serving, add fresh fruit like bananas, apples, or berries for a refreshing touch.

Storage Tips
Overnight oats can be stored in the refrigerator for up to five days, making them an excellent option for meal prep. Here are some tips for keeping them fresh:
- Use Airtight Containers: Store your oats in airtight jars or containers to prevent them from drying out and to maintain their flavor.
- Keep Toppings Separate: If you’re using fresh fruits or nuts, consider adding them just before serving to maintain their texture and freshness.
- Freeze for Later: If you want to prepare a larger batch, you can freeze portions of your overnight oats. Just thaw them in the refrigerator overnight before enjoying.
- Check for Freshness: Before consuming, always check for any signs of spoilage, especially if storing for several days.

Perfecting the Texture
The texture of your overnight oats can greatly influence your enjoyment of this breakfast. Here are some tips to achieve the perfect consistency:
- Milk Ratios: Adjust the amount of milk based on your preference for thicker or creamier oats. Start with a 1:1 ratio of oats to milk and adjust as needed.
- Blend for Smoothness: For a smoother texture, blend your oats with milk before adding other ingredients. This will create a creamy base.
- Let It Sit: Allow your oats to soak for at least 4 hours, or overnight, to ensure they absorb the liquid and soften properly.
